Transaction 70335107aeb466c4d7c800c142789d7086d5bbbb623220466a6554e64eb41c07
1 Input
2 Outputs
- 70335107aeb466c4d7c800c142789d7086d5bbbb623220466a6554e64eb41c07:0
- 70335107aeb466c4d7c800c142789d7086d5bbbb623220466a6554e64eb41c07:1
value 420696
address 14mEDzk7oHok17mGHW7xLWzEBZPFn9pTrU
value 1629173
address 1NKcm5zaVdGRDiarLs8rLKfewUKEtFoJd4